JAVA对XML文件的操作

应工作需要。让我搞多数据源。

要求要我在applicationContext中配置多数据源
将其中一个先注释.
根据用户的选择去选择释放相应的数据源.
也就是说配置文件中不能同时有两个数据源同时出现

怎么做

譬如:datasourse
datasourse;

系统在用户登录时默认有一个.这个的当前没有被注释。
当用户更改了datasourse的类时,另一个datasourse冒上会注释.

这怎么搞(≧▽≦)/

建议换种思路,为什么一定要去修改XML,修改对象不得了?
利用spring IOC容器的API,对相应的Bean进行修改,如dataSource;

建议使用dom4J试试!